Good video Kieron, Hebden got famous and popular because of a advert for the new town of Milton Keynes. The advert showed a picture of the brand new sparkling Milton Keynes and said why don't you come and live here, or you could live in this run down mill town of Hebden, with a picture showing an old derelict factory, taken in the rain. People started to look at Hebden and the house prices and they packed their pink pants and flowery shirts and moved up north.

If you enjoy a pint try the Fox and Goose, a community pub noted for its pristine ales, situated at the junction of the A646 (King Street) and Heptonstall Road. Just up the road to Heptonstall is (what was) a council estate built just after Word War 2. The houses were built from stone reclaimed from the Duke of Bridgewater's Worsley New Hall. Regards.

Loved the video Kieran, don't know if you watched the Gallows Pole on BBC, this was about the Cragg Vale coiners. Their leader David Hartley was hung at the Tyburn in York and his body was buried in the original St Thomas's grave yard, not alot of people know that :).
